I'm doing a full contribution for Star Trek (2009) Norwegian release, and I'm having difficulties deciding if Gene Roddenberry should be entered, and if he is, what would be the correct credit.

He is credited on-screen as;

Based upon "Star Trek"
      Created by
Gene Roddenberry

I would enter him as OCB.  The film is not adapted from another medium, it is based on characters from another work...the TV series, which Roddenberry created.  Some people want to make it 'Created by', but that isn't correct as he didn't 'create' the film, just the TV series.  Just my, unemotional, opinion.

The credit:
Based upon "Star Trek"
      Created by
Gene Roddenberry

is in every "Star Trek" film, and it is profiled as OCB in all the profiles except "Star Trek VI".
There is an upgrade pending (submitted by me) with 3 yes and 6 no.
Some people say that "Created by" is correct, not OCB, because no mention is made of characters, but of an entire universe; other say "Created by" is correct, not OCB, no mention is made of characters, but of an entire universe.
I think that the only contibution of GR to the films are the original characters.
